An unfortunate result for a team that dominated the entire match. Mourinho fielded an inexperienced defense and it showed, United took it to Inter in the first half with plenty of opportunities because of weak defending mainly by Rivas.
I did have an issue with Giggs though, I do believe he is in great shape, but there were a couple of plays where he wanted to be the hero and didn’t make the right decision. For example, in the 16th minute he took a free kick that went right into the wall! I couldn’t remember the last time Giggsy scored a free kick! So I decided to YouTube “Ryan Giggs free kicks” and all I got was PES and FIFA videos. So why the hell did he take that kick?
Another play I felt he could have done better on was the break he got from Nelson Rivas, he took the shot on goal but had such a tough angle and the way Julio Cesar was playing, he was never gonna score, he should have played the ball square to Berbatov!
And I really don’t think he should have been out there for 90 minutes.
Everyone else played really well, I was pleasantly surprised by both Johnny Evans and John O’Shea! Containing Ibrahimovic and Adriano is no easy task! Park did what he does best, plays within himself. I would like to have seen a little more of Berbatov.
Overall I feel we have a great advantage going into the return leg. If everyone can stay healthy and Vidic can keep from getting suspended, we should have a much stronger team for the decisive match at Old Trafford!
